When We Were Bad is a spellbinding, witty and poignant portrayal of a family in crisis, in love, and in denial.''As intelligent as it is funny. A beautifully observed literary comedy as well as a painfully accurate description of one big old family mess. A joy'' – The ObserverIn North London, Claudia Rubin is in her heyday. Wife, mother, rabbi – and sometimes moral voice of the nation – everyone wants to be with her at her son Leo''s glorious wedding. That is, until Leo jilts his bride, and the gleaming bubble surrounding the Rubins threatens to burst.Frances – Claudia''s calm, mature, married daughter – tries to hold the nucleus of the family together, but the stress forces her to re-examine her own life, leading her to make a decision as shocking as Leo''s choice to bolt.And Claudia''s husband, Norman, has an uncharacteristic secret. And, whether he likes it or not, he is powerless to stop it coming out . . .''A comedy with the warmest of hearts and the most deliciously subversive of agendas'' - Marie Claire''Fast-paced and engaging. Brilliant, touching and true'' - Naomi Alderman, bestselling author of The Power
